My Girl 2 is a 1994 American comedy-drama film. A sequel to the 1991 film My Girl, it was directed by Howard Zieff from a screenplay written by Janet Kovalcik, and starring Dan Aykroyd, Jamie Lee Curtis, Anna Chlumsky and Austin O'Brien.

Directed by. Howard Zieff. The original "My Girl" (1991) was about an 11-year-old girl whose dad is an undertaker. Midway through the movie, her best friend suddenly dies. In "My Girl 2," the heroine is about 13, and goes on a quest for information about the mother she never knew, who died two days after giving birth.
Summaries. Vada Sultenfuss must go to LA to stay with her Uncle Phil to do some research on her mother's life, but finds much more. Vada Sultenfuss has a holiday coming up, and an assignment to do an essay on someone she admires and has never met.
